Abstract
The study is devoted to the peculiarities of the immune response in long-
term non-healing wounds and methods for predicting and preventing infectious
complications. Changes in cellular and humoral immunity were studied in 120
patients with chronic wounds. Assessment of inflammatory markers, blood cell
composition, and cytokine activity showed significant impairment of immune
activity, which increases the risk of generalization of infection. The study used a
combination therapy with immunomodulators and antibacterial drugs. The
results obtained allow us to develop effective methods for preventing infectious
complications and improving the prognosis of healing.

Relevance
Long-term non-healing wounds are a problem associated with a high risk
of infectious complications, including generalization of infection, which leads to
severe consequences, such as sepsis. Understanding the immune mechanisms
involved in wound healing is key to developing effective prevention methods.
Disorders in cellular and humoral immunity contribute to delayed healing and
increase the frequency of infection. Predicting the risks of generalization of
infection and applying proper prevention is crucial for improving the clinical
outcome. The relevance of the work is confirmed by the need to develop more
effective strategies for the treatment and prevention of complications in chronic
wounds, which will help reduce the incidence and improve the quality of life of
patients.

Results
Out of 120 patients, 68% had abnormalities in immune activity, including
decreased T-cell count and increased levels of inflammatory cytokines. In 45%
of cases, the development of infectious complications requiring intensive care
was observed. The use of combination therapy with immunomodulators and
antibacterial agents reduced the frequency of generalization of infection by 32%
and accelerated wound healing by 18% compared to the control group. There
was also a correlation between cytokine levels and healing rates.
Conclusion
Disorders of immune activity in patients with chronic wounds play a key role in
the development of infectious complications and generalization of infection. Risk
prediction and timely prevention with the use of immunomodulators and
antibacterial drugs helps to improve treatment outcomes. A comprehensive
approach, including the diagnosis of the immune response, can optimize therapy
and reduce the frequency of infections.
